Technical Problem

Existing passive device housings are prone to deformation and cracking when subjected to external mechanical stress, and the limited internal space of the housing makes it difficult to miniaturize the devices.

Method used

Design a passive device housing with reinforcing ribs, including a housing body and reinforcing ribs, setting an expansion cavity and a main mounting cavity, and forming a heat dissipation channel through a through connection hole. Use conductive coating and corrugated surface structure to improve housing strength and heat dissipation performance.

Abstract

本实用新型公开了一种带有加强筋的无源器件壳体,包括壳体主体与加强筋,壳体主体的上侧敞口,形成主安装腔,壳体主体的一侧设置有与主安装腔连通的输入口与输出口,壳体主体的下侧设置有开口向下的扩展腔,主安装腔与扩展腔之间通过过孔连通,加强筋下侧与主安装腔底部固定连接,沿加强筋设置有多个连接孔,连接孔的上端形成上连接口,至少部分连接孔下端贯穿至扩展腔的周围,形成下连接口,壳体还包括上盖板、下盖板、上螺纹件与下螺纹件,上螺纹件上下贯穿设置有上散热孔,下螺纹件上下贯穿设置有下散热孔,上散热孔、连接孔与下散热孔之间形成散热通道。本实用新型提出一种壳体,在保证强度下,体积更小,方便无源器件小型化。

Claims

1. A passive device housing with a stiffener, characterized by, The casing body is provided with a main installation cavity, an input port and an output port, an expansion cavity, a first reinforcing rib and a second reinforcing rib.

2. A passive device housing with stiffener according to claim 1, wherein, The first reinforcing rib is arranged around the inner periphery of the casing body, and the second reinforcing rib is arranged on the inner side of the first reinforcing rib.

3. A passive device housing with stiffener according to claim 2, wherein, The first reinforcing rib and the second reinforcing rib are arranged in a herringbone structure to form two independent main installation cavities.

4. The passive device housing with stiffener of claim 1, wherein, The side surface of the reinforcing rib is provided with a wave surface.

5. The passive device housing with stiffener of claim 1, wherein, The surface of the reinforcing rib is provided with a conductive coating.

6. The passive device housing with stiffener of claim 1, wherein, The expansion cavity is fixedly connected with an expansion rib.

7. The passive device housing with stiffener of claim 1, wherein, The lower side of the casing body is provided with a groove matched with the lower side of the lower cover plate. The lower side of the lower cover plate is flush with the lower side of the casing body.
